Optimizing Performance and Design of Globe Valves in Industrial Applications

Understanding Globe Valves Functionality and Applications


Globe valves are an essential component in various piping systems across industries. Their design and functionality make them ideal for throttling and regulating the flow of fluids. Notably, the globe valve operates on the principle of a movable disk or plug that fits into a seat, which allows for precise control over the fluid passage. In this article, we'll explore the globe valve's features, applications, and benefits.


Construction and Design


The globe valve is characterized by its spherical body, which contains an internal baffle that directs the fluid flow in a straight line. This design is significant because it minimizes turbulence and pressure drop, ensuring efficient fluid transfer. The components of a globe valve include the body, bonnet, disc, seat, and stem. The valve's ability to adjust flow rates is achieved through its unique stem-and-disk assembly that allows for varying degrees of opening.


Apart from their basic construction, globe valves come in various materials such as brass, stainless steel, cast iron, and PVC, catering to different service requirements. The choice of material and the valve's size depend on the application, pressure, and temperature of the fluid being handled.


Functionality


One of the primary functions of a globe valve is its capability to control the flow of liquid or gas with precision. When the valve is fully open, the flow restriction is minimal, allowing for max fluid transfer. However, as the valve closes, the flow rate decreases proportionally, enabling operators to manage the fluid dynamics effectively.


Globe valves can also provide tight sealing when fully closed, making them suitable for applications requiring shut-off capabilities. This is particularly important in systems where leakage could lead to safety hazards or significant operational costs. Because of this feature, globe valves are commonly used in applications requiring frequent adjustments rather than fully on-off scenarios.

Globe valves find extensive applications across various industries. They are widely used in


1. Water Treatment Plants Regulating water flow and maintaining desired pressure levels in treatment processes. 2. Oil and Gas Industry Controlling the flow of crude oil and natural gas in pipelines and processing facilities. 3. Chemical Processing Managing the flow of raw materials and finished products in chemical reaction vessels. 4. HVAC Systems Regulating heating and cooling fluid flow within building systems to ensure comfort. 5. Power Plants Controlling steam and water flow in different components of power generation systems.


Each of these applications benefits from the globe valve's reliability and precision, which are crucial for maintaining process efficiency and safety.
